to occur; to happen
Meaning & usage
to occur; to happen
Wie konnte das nur geschehen?
Dein Wille geschehe, wie im Himmel so auf Erden.
to happen
Was ist (mit) dir geschehen?
to serve right, to be deserved [with dative ‘someone’ and recht ‘right’] (in this construction passieren is not possible)
Das geschieht ihm recht.
Where this word comes from
From Middle High German geschehen, geschēn, geschegen, from Old High German giskehan, scehan, from Proto-West Germanic *skehan (“to spring, come up, emerge, happen”). Cognate to Bavarian gschehn and Dutch geschieden.
